ABOUT THE ARTIST

Bridey McGlynn (she/her/hers) is a painter and printmaker from Northborough, Massachusetts. She earned her MFA in 2D Fine Art at Massachusetts College of Art and Design and received her BFA in Studio Arts from Syracuse University. She currently works as a Registrar and Printmaking Instructor at Worcester Center for Crafts in Worcester, MA. Bridey's work was most recently exhibited in "A Fervent Chorus" at Doran Gallery in Boston, MA, "New Talent" at Alpha Gallery in Boston, MA, "The 87th Regional Exhibition of Art and Craft" at Fitchburg Art Museum, in Fitchburg, MA, and Art League RI's exhibition, entitled "Connect", in Providence, RI. She was also a recent recipient of the ArtsWorcester 2023 Material Needs Grant and the 2025 George Nick Prize.
